A primary advantage of the HCA curriculum lies in its clinical practicum component. Students do not learn in simulated isolation; they operate within HCA’s active hospitals under the guidance of veteran Clinical Preceptors. This immersion ensures that students are proficient with Electronic Health Records (EHR), automated pharmacy dispensing systems, and sophisticated monitoring technologies prior to graduation.

The mandatory path to LPN licensure is the NCLEX-PN examination. HCA’s program includes built-in intensive modules that utilize data analytics to track historical exam trends, providing students with precise content coverage and mock testing to significantly enhance first-time pass rates.
The following table delineates the key phases of the HCA curriculum and their role in building professional expertise:
| Phase | Core Module Name | Focus Areas | HCA-Specific Competency Output |
| Phase I | Medical Foundations | Anatomy, Pathophysiology, Healthcare Law | Establishes rigorous medical logic and legal boundary awareness. |
| Phase II | Clinical Nursing Core | Vital Sign Monitoring, Medication Tech, Wound Care | Mastery of HCA’s official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s). |
| Phase III | Specialized Essentials | Geriatrics, OB-GYN Nursing, Mental Health | Capability to handle complex patients across diverse departments. |
| Phase IV | HCA System Integration | HMS Usage, Team Collaboration Protocols | Seamless transition into HCA’s digital medical environment. |
| Phase V | Clinical Practicum | Hospital Rotations, Preceptor-Led Internship | Transition from student to nurse in high-pressure environments. |
| Phase VI | Licensure Sprint | NCLEX Simulations, Content Analysis | Final preparation for National LPN Licensure certification. |
